Our verdict is Benign. The variant received -11 ACMG points: 0P and 11B. BP4_StrongBP6_ModerateBP7BS2
The NM_001961.4(EEF2):c.2115C>T(p.His705His)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000864 in 1,573,310 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

EEF2 (HGNC:3214): (eukaryotic translation elongation factor 2) This gene encodes a member of the GTP-binding translation elongation factor family. This protein is an essential factor for protein synthesis. It promotes the GTP-dependent translocation of the nascent protein chain from the A-site to the P-site of the ribosome. This protein is completely inactivated by EF-2 kinase phosporylation. [provided by RefSeq, Jul 2008]
